Job Description - Sr. Manager, ER- LAM/NAM

PURPOSE AND OVERALL RELEVANCE FOR THE ORGANIZATION

This is a new role serving as primary Employee Relations support for the LAM (Latin America) geography and providing a potential of 25% percent of support for the NAM (North America) geography. You will work alongside the NAM Dir Employee Relations and the LAM VP HR to implement the ER strategy ensuring a consistent employee experience across the Globe. As an ER Sr Manager you are required to educate and advise the HR Team, Leaders and Employees about ER related policies, investigate concerns about potential policy violations and other workplace behavior, and support our employees through challenging workplace situations. A strong analyst, effective communicator, and calm operator, you’ll make recommendations and decisions that have a direct impact on stewarding the adidas culture.

ROLE CAN BE BASED IN PORTLAND OR LOS ANGELES.

 

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

• Serving as the primary Employee Relations resource in LAM and therefore bringing the Global ER Model to life in the LAM geography
• Building Relationships, Creating Value and Establishing Credibility for the Global ER Function with the LAM HR Team, Leaders and Stakeholders in the LAM Geography
• Managing a system for documenting, triaging, and processing policy violations and other workplace concerns including the development and delivery of relevant user trainings
• Responsible for assigned employee relations matters primarily in LAM however, including NAM, under the direction of the NAM Director Employee Relations and Global ER
• Drive the execution of the ER global framework for all key ER activities
• Conducts complex investigations in relation to ER matters e.g. bullying, harassment, discrimination, retaliation and other complex misconduct
• Restores organizational health following an investigation or conflict in the workplace
• Provides advice and counsel in a manner that is credible and inspires trust and engagement when complex workplace issues arise among employees at key points of the employee life cycle such as performance management and end of employment 
• Facilitates the resolution of complex disputes between different parties
• Supports and prepares regular ER reporting to all relevant stakeholder
• Responsible for maintaining accurate ER records within a Case Management System allowing collaboration with key partners to share data insights and trends
• Advises and trains managers and/or HR Business Partners on key ER processes and performs as an ER subject matter expert role
• Champions the adidas values and behaviors to drive a feedback culture

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S AND ABILITIES
• Expertise in conducting complex workplace investigations and restoration of organizational health
• Expertise in Employee Relations crisis management issues e.g., societal movements #metoo
• Expertise in conflict resolution
• Knowledge of discrimination and harassment laws in key LAM countries / NAM would be a plus; knowledge of LAM/NAM Employment/Labor Laws is a plus
• Ability to comprehend, interpret, and apply the appropriate sections of applicable laws, guidelines, regulations, and policies; with support from local legal and compliance resources
• Ability to negotiate internally to drive the acceptance of changes in existing practices and adoption of new standards and concepts; Influence and drive change
• Utilize a variety of influencing techniques and dispute resolution methods
• Ability to remain tactful, calm, and persuasive in controversial and/or confrontational situations
• Strong interpersonal, collaboration and communication skills with a proven ability to handle sensitive matters with empathy, tact and diplomacy
• Proven consensus building skills
• Ability to work in and thrive in a changing business environment
• Fluent in English and Spanish; speaking, reading and writing 

 

REQUISITE E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E/M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S

• Bachelor’s Degree, Preferably in Business or Human Resources, or Related Field
• Min. 4+ years experience in Human Resources or Compliance field preferred with either direct Employee Relations experience or exposure to Employee Relations and investigations.
• Knowledge of sporting goods industry beneficial; Corp, Retail and DC experience valued
• Fluent in English and Spanish; speaking, reading and writing
